The cheapest way to get from Gothenburg to Delsjön is to line 754 bus which costs 14 kr - 50 kr and takes 11 min.
The fastest way to get from Gothenburg to Delsjön is to taxi which takes 10 min and costs 250 kr - 300 kr.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Göteborg Heden and arriving at Kalvemossen.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 11 min.
The distance between Gothenburg and Delsjön is 13 km.
The best way to get from Gothenburg to Delsjön without a car is to line 754 bus which takes 11 min and costs 14 kr - 50 kr.
The line 754 bus from Göteborg Heden to Kalvemossen takes 11 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Gothenburg to Delsjön bus services, operated by Vasttrafik, depart from Göteborg Heden station.
Gothenburg to Delsjön bus services, operated by Vasttrafik, arrive at Kalvemossen station.
